一、开发者工具类SaaS:提升研发效率的核心选择
1.1 代码协作与项目管理
对于分布式开发团队,云端代码托管与协作平台是刚需。典型方案支持多分支管理、自动化代码审查、持续集成(CI)与持续部署(CD)流水线。例如,某主流平台提供基于Git的代码仓库,集成AI驱动的代码补全功能,可减少30%以上的重复编码工作。其架构采用微服务设计,支持横向扩展,单实例可处理每日百万级代码提交。
关键指标:
- 响应延迟:全球节点平均<150ms
- 并发能力:支持千人级团队同时操作
- 集成生态:兼容主流CI工具(如Jenkins替代方案)
1.2 低代码开发平台
面向非专业开发者的可视化开发工具,通过拖拽组件与配置逻辑生成可执行代码。某领先平台提供预置模板库,覆盖Web应用、移动端及IoT设备管理场景。其技术亮点在于:
- 模型驱动架构(MDA):自动生成前后端代码
- 多环境部署:一键发布至公有云或私有环境
- 扩展接口:支持自定义组件与API对接
典型案例:某企业通过该平台构建客户管理系统,开发周期从3个月缩短至2周,维护成本降低60%。
二、企业级服务类SaaS:支撑业务增长的技术基石
2.1 客户关系管理(CRM)
全球化企业需要多语言、多时区支持的CRM系统。某头部产品提供智能销售预测、自动化工作流及客户行为分析功能。其技术架构采用分布式数据库,支持每秒万级请求处理,数据同步延迟<1秒。核心模块包括:
- 动态表单引擎:自定义字段与业务规则
- AI助手:自动识别销售机会风险
- 集成市场:连接邮件、社交媒体等渠道
选型建议:优先选择支持API开放生态的平台,便于与内部ERP、财务系统对接。
2.2 数据分析与BI工具
面向数据驱动型企业的云端BI平台,需具备实时数据处理、可视化仪表盘及机器学习集成能力。某主流方案提供:
- 流式计算引擎:支持每秒百万级事件处理
- 自然语言查询:通过语音或文本生成数据报表
- 嵌入式分析:将BI模块集成至第三方应用
性能优化:
# 示例:使用某平台Python SDK优化数据查询from sdk_client import BIClientclient = BIClient(api_key="YOUR_KEY", region="us-east")query = client.create_query(dataset="sales_2023",metrics=["revenue", "conversion_rate"],filters=[{"field": "region", "operator": "=", "value": "APAC"}],cache_enabled=True # 启用查询缓存)result = query.execute(timeout=10) # 设置超时阈值
三、安全与合规类SaaS:保障全球化运营的必备方案
3.1 零信任安全架构
基于身份的访问控制(IBAC)成为主流。某解决方案通过持续认证、最小权限原则及动态策略引擎,实现:
- 多因素认证(MFA):支持生物识别、硬件令牌
- 微隔离:按应用或数据敏感度划分安全域
- 威胁情报集成:实时阻断恶意IP访问
实施步骤:
- 梳理资产与权限模型
- 部署策略引擎与代理节点
- 制定应急响应流程
3.2 数据合规管理
针对GDPR、CCPA等法规的自动化合规工具,可扫描代码库、数据库及API接口中的敏感数据,生成合规报告并自动修复问题。某平台提供:
- 静态与动态分析:识别未加密传输、过度权限等问题
- 政策引擎:自定义合规规则库
- 审计日志:不可篡改的操作记录
技术架构:采用无服务器计算(Serverless)处理敏感数据,避免数据落地至中间节点。
四、选型方法论:从需求到落地的完整路径
4.1 需求分析与场景匹配
- 开发者场景:优先评估API兼容性、开发语言支持及调试工具链
- 企业场景:关注数据主权、SLA保障及成本模型(按需/预留)
4.2 供应商评估框架
| 维度 | 关键指标 | 权重 |
|---|---|---|
| 技术能力 | 架构弹性、故障恢复时间 | 30% |
| 生态集成 | 第三方插件数量、API开放程度 | 25% |
| 成本效益 | 单用户成本、隐性费用(如数据导出) | 20% |
| 支持服务 | 响应时效、文档完整性 | 15% |
| 合规认证 | SOC2、ISO27001等资质 | 10% |
4.3 迁移与集成策略
- 渐进式迁移:先试点非核心业务,逐步扩展至关键系统
- 双活架构:通过API网关实现新旧系统并行运行
- 数据同步:使用CDC(变更数据捕获)技术保持数据一致
五、未来趋势与技术演进
5.1 AI增强型SaaS
生成式AI正在重塑SaaS交互方式。例如,某CRM平台通过自然语言处理(NLP)实现:
- 语音驱动的客户记录创建
- 自动生成销售跟进邮件
- 预测性客户流失预警
5.2 边缘计算集成
为降低延迟,部分SaaS提供商将计算节点部署至边缘位置。某物联网平台通过边缘网关实现:
- 本地数据处理(减少云端传输)
- 断网环境下的离线操作
- 低至10ms的响应时间
5.3 可持续性设计
绿色SaaS成为新趋势,通过优化资源利用率减少碳足迹。某数据中心采用液冷技术,使PUE(电源使用效率)降至1.1以下,相比传统方案节能40%。
结语
选择国外SaaS工具需平衡技术先进性与落地可行性。建议从核心业务场景出发,优先验证供应商的技术支持能力与数据合规水平。对于全球化企业,可结合百度智能云等国内服务商的本地化优势,构建混合云架构以实现成本与性能的最优解。未来,随着AI与边缘计算的深度融合,SaaS工具将进一步向智能化、场景化方向发展,开发者需持续关注技术演进以保持竞争力。